Solar Storm Preparedness – Earth Will Only Have A 12-Hour Warning Before The Next Carrington Event Hits

Wednesday, July 29, 2015 14:05
%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.

(Before It's News)

A “Space Weather Preparedness Strategy” report just released by United Kingdom officials, stated that we will only have a 12-hour warning before a sever solar storm, or X-Class solar flare, hits Earth. The Department of Business, Innovation and Skills report aptly noted the unpredictability of solar flares and said government officials and emergency and disaster responders will have a short window to prepare for a power grid down situation.

The UK solar storm report also cited the Carrington Event of 1859 when detailing the dire impact of coronal mass ejections – CMS. A massive solar storm is historically likely to happen approximately every 100 to 200 years. During the Carrington Event, the Earth was hit with a wave of “energetic particles” followed by a powerful solar flare.
